Makeup Meltdown: Skincare Mistakes You're Probably Making

1. Skipping moisturizer

If you skip moisturizer, your skin will appear dehydrated and your makeup will appear patchy and flaky.

2. Not using a primer

Primer helps to create a smooth foundation for makeup, increases its durability, and reduces the appearance of pores and fine lines.

3. Applying makeup on unclean skin

Before applying makeup to unclean skin, it is essential to cleanse the face thoroughly to remove any grime, oil, or product residue.

4. Using expired or old makeup products

Using expired cosmetics can cause skin irritation, rashes, and infections. Check the expiration dates of your cosmetics.

5. Overloading on foundation

Excessive application of foundation can cause the skin to appear cakey and thick. Instead, begin with a scant layer of foundation and build coverage where necessary. 

6. Not blending properly

For a flawless finish, it is essential to blend your makeup products appropriately. Take the time to thoroughly blend your foundation.

7. Neglecting sunscreen

Not using sunscreen increases the risk of premature aging, UV damage, and skin cancer. Select a sunscreen with a minimum SPF of 30.

8. Sleeping with makeup on

Leaving makeup on overnight can obstruct pores, cause acne, and irritate the skin. Always remove your makeup with a mild cleanser before bed.

9. Using harsh makeup wipes

Makeup wipes are convenient, but they can be harsh and dehydrating to the skin.
